Inspiring Next Generation of Makers in Massachusetts

Written by Larissa Hofman | January 24, 2016 at 12:00 AM

Massachusetts Manufacturing Extension Partnership (MassMEP), a leading resource for manufacturing companies in Massachusetts, is partnering with production company Edge Factor, to provide 33 high schools that teach Machine Tool Technology with eduFACTOR’s story-driven media and supporting resources to inspire students, reach parents and engage audiences (available via www.edufactor.org).

For the next 12 months, MassMEP is providing all educators at each of the 33 schools with an eduFACTOR membership to access these high impact resources. “We are seeing perceptions change across our state, as students and parents watch Edge Factor media and engage with eduFACTOR tools. This is the second year we are funding schools with eduFACTOR memberships and it’s amazing to see the impact it’s having on the next generation in Massachusetts,” said Leslie Parady, MassMEP’s Workforce Development Manager.
